> Troubleshooting Quiz. (quiz?)
>
> One of the radios in the stable an AGC problem. On strong AM
> signals, depending on the modulation, it gives me an an AGC
> response. On certain types of music/voice - I listen to talk radio
> quite a bit - it clips on peaks, very quickly dumps AGC, momentarily
> increases gain then quickly settles back to where it was. Again,
> this only happens with certain voice types, it doesn't happen with
> most types of music, it usually doesn't happen with rapid Spanish
> speech. Do I really have a problem, or does this radio have Dallas'
> mod installed? It seems to copy SSB very well compared to the other
> radios.
>
> I've not removed the dust covers nor pulled the IF deck to confirm
> this, but monitoring the AGC line shows my ears are correct. I've
> only used this radio a few times since I've had it - and only on the
> hand bands. I don't believe I've installed the Langford mod in any
> of my other radios, so I'm not familiar with it's behaviour on strong
> AM.
